Title: Sadao Matsumura: Innovator in Surface Acoustic Wave Devices
Introduction
Sadao Matsumura is a notable inventor based in Inagi,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of surface acoustic wave devices, holding a total of 6 patents. His work has advanced the technology used in various electronic applications.
Latest Patents
Matsumura's latest patents include a surface acoustic wave device that features a surface acoustic wave filter. This filter is designed with multiple electroacoustic interdigital electrodes formed as thin films primarily made of aluminum on a Li₂B₄O₇ single crystal substrate. Additionally, he has developed a surface acoustic wave resonator that incorporates grating reflectors for reflecting surface acoustic waves. The design ensures that the cut angle of the substrate and the propagation direction of the surface acoustic wave are optimized, achieving a temperature coefficient of frequency (TCD) below ±5 ppm/°C and a coupling coefficient K² of about 1.0%. Furthermore, he has patented a method for controlling the shape of a single crystal, which involves detecting the weight of a single crystal pulled by the Czochralski method and adjusting the heating power supplied to the crucible to maintain a constant growing angle.
Career Highlights
Throughout his career, Matsumura has worked with prominent companies such as Tokyo Shibaura Denki Kabushiki Kaisha and Tokyo Shibaura Electric Co., Ltd. His experience in these organizations has contributed to his expertise in the field of crystal growth and acoustic wave technology.
Collaborations
Matsumura has collaborated with notable coworkers, including Hitoshi Hirano and Hitoshi Suzuki. Their joint efforts have furthered advancements in their respective fields.
